The location is brilliant, right at the entrance to the main shopping mall where there are many eateries and a Woolworths. In a beautiful heritage city building. Easy walking distance to Salamanca and the wharves/ harbour area. Room was large, clean, comfortable and well-equipped. Good quality bed linen and towels to the quality of a 5 star hotel.
Those who like windows that open will likely be disappointed. I saw benefits to this though as it blocked out any street noise and meant the room was well insulated and stayed warm. I had my own remote controlled split system air conditioner (hot and cold) but did not need to use it on a 6° night. There is no hotel restaurant on site, but you don't really need this as it is surrounded by restaurants and cafes open every day.

What are the check-in and check-out times at Quest Savoy?
Your reservation at Quest Savoy specifies a check-in timeframe of 02:00 PM to 07:00 PM, and a check-out deadline of 10:00 AM.
Does Quest Savoy come with parking?
Yes, there is parking available at Quest Savoy hotel. The parking is at a nearby location and is a public parking lot. It costs A$27 per day to park at the hotel. There is no need to make a reservation for parking.
